Hands-on Scratch Programming and Game Development

Imagine, Create and Share scratch programming and 2D games (Comprehensive Guide for newbies)
Instructor:
Osama Ali
1,499 students enrolled
English [Auto]
Fundamental programming concepts
Real time 2D game development
Animation editing
Story Making and Publishing

Programming has never been fun to experience. I am sure you will enjoy as much as I was enthralled while recording lectures for hours on end of this course.  There are endless attributes of this course following are some of the perks and learning outcomes of this amazing crash course. 

  • This course is scientifically designed for students with little to no knowledge about programming and who are struggling to understand coding concepts in their schools/high schools.

  • Students will be able to understand and apply coding concepts in no time.

  • It contains complete hands on guide from account creation to game development

  • Concepts of coding blocks are explicitly described in each section.

  • Each section contains game oriented lectures of programming concepts

  • Almost all the coding blocks are covered in  scratch 3.0 programming course.

  • Students will be able to practically apply the concepts of controls, sensing, functions, variables, mathematical operators etc. in scratch platform.

  • Students will be able to grab the concepts of script programming i.e. python, C,C++ etc. after taking this course.

  • This course is useful for both students and professional instructor because all lectures contain step by step optimized guide to understand functionality of coding blocks rather than just dragging onto the screen.

Getting start with Scratch 3.0

1
How to make free account on Scratch 3.0?

Students will be able to quickly make a free account on web-based scratch 3.0 software without any potential mistakes.

2
Complete Guided tour of Scratch 3.0 Software.
  1. All coding sections will be introduced. Students will be able to differentiate and identify specific coding blocks withs color and functionality.

  2. Students will able to locate and import different types of sprites and background

  3. Students will develop overall understanding of scratch platform

3
How to save and load different projects from computer?
  • Students will be able to save and load their projects without losing it.

  • Students will learn how to publish their projects on scratch 3.0.

Section 2: Getting started with Scratch Programming Blocks

1
Understand Coordinate system (XY-Grid)
2
What is the difference between animation and Games ?

Students will be able to differentiate the difference between animation and games.


3
Design animated start page of any game

Create Maze Finder Game Challenge

1
Maze Finder game part 1

In this lecture following blocks and topics are covered.

  1. Event block

  2. Forever loop

  3. IF Then Block (Conditional)

  4. Sensing block for (Enable control)


2
Maze Finder Game part 2

In this lecture, students will learn how to import backgrounds as well as create a customized backdrop using animation editor/costumes.

Followins blocks and topics are covered in this lecture

  1. Sensing block for sensing colors

  2. Text block for display (Game start/Game Over)

  3. Import backdrops/canvas

  4. Create customized backdrop

  5. Coordinate system block i.e GoTO specefic positon


Develop Striker/Pong Game

1
Striker Game part 1
2
Striker Game part 2
3
Striker Game part 3

Design and Develop Flappy Bird game

1
Flappy Bird Part 1
2
Flappy Bird Part 2
3
Flappy Bird Part 3
4
Flappy Bird Part 4

Congratulations

1
Achievement Unlocked
You can view and review the lecture materials indefinitely, like an on-demand channel.
Definitely! If you have an internet connection, courses on Udemy are available on any device at any time. If you don't have an internet connection, some instructors also let their students download course lectures. That's up to the instructor though, so make sure you get on their good side!

Be the first to add a review.

Please, login to leave a review
0db000367d5a62c53304680f97cd95f9
30-Day Money-Back Guarantee

Includes

1 hours on-demand video
Full lifetime access
Access on mobile and TV
Certificate of Completion

External Links May Contain Affiliate Links read more

Join our Telegram Channel To Get Latest Notification & Course Updates!
Join Our Telegram For FREE Courses & Canva PremiumJOIN NOW